5 Steps: How to Scan WordPress Vulnerabilities Using VirtualBox
Hello, security enthusiast! Ready to dive into the world of WordPress security?
Ever wondered how many WordPress sites are vulnerable to attack each day? The number is staggering, and you don’t want to be a statistic!
Why settle for a potentially compromised site when you can proactively protect it? Think of it as giving your website a thorough health check-up.
Is setting up a virtual environment for testing too complicated? Don’t worry, we’ll make it surprisingly simple. Think of it as building a digital sandbox—safe and fun!
What’s better than a perfectly secure WordPress site? Absolutely nothing! Let’s get started.
5 Steps: How to Scan WordPress Vulnerabilities Using VirtualBox will guide you through a surprisingly straightforward process. Stay tuned for a surprisingly easy solution to a potentially serious problem. Ready to learn how?
We’ll cover everything from setting up VirtualBox to running the scans. Stick with us until the end – you won’t regret it!
5 Steps: How to Scan WordPress Vulnerabilities Using VirtualBox
Meta Description: Learn how to effectively scan your WordPress site for vulnerabilities using VirtualBox in 5 easy steps. This comprehensive guide covers essential tools, techniques, and best practices for enhanced website security.
Meta Keywords: WordPress vulnerability scanning, VirtualBox, WordPress security, website security, vulnerability assessment, penetration testing, WordPress plugins, OWASP, security audit
WordPress powers a significant portion of the internet’s websites, making it a prime target for cyberattacks. Regular WordPress vulnerability scanning is crucial for maintaining the security and integrity of your website. This guide details a five-step process using VirtualBox, a powerful virtualization tool, to create a safe testing environment for identifying and mitigating potential vulnerabilities. We’ll explore various scanning methods and best practices to ensure your WordPress site remains secure.
1. Setting Up Your VirtualBox Environment
Before initiating any vulnerability scans, establishing a secure virtual environment is paramount. This prevents accidental damage to your live website. VirtualBox, a free and open-source virtualization software, provides an isolated space for testing.
1.1 Installing VirtualBox
Download and install the latest version of VirtualBox from the official Oracle website. Link to Oracle VirtualBox. The installation process is straightforward and should be completed according to the provided instructions.
1.2 Creating a Virtual Machine (VM)
Once installed, create a new virtual machine. Choose a suitable operating system (e.g., Ubuntu, Kali Linux – known for its penetration testing tools). Allocate sufficient resources (RAM, hard drive space) to your VM to ensure smooth operation.
1.3 Installing WordPress on the VM
After the VM is created and the OS installed, download and install a fresh copy of WordPress. This mimics your live site and allows for vulnerability scanning without risking your actual data. Remember to use a separate database for the virtual instance.
2. Choosing the Right Vulnerability Scanner
Several tools are available for WordPress vulnerability scanning. The choice depends on your technical expertise and specific needs.
2.1 Open-Source Scanners
OWASP ZAP (Zed Attack Proxy) is a widely used, free and open-source web application security scanner. It offers a comprehensive range of features for identifying various vulnerabilities. Link to OWASP ZAP.
2.2 Commercial Scanners
Commercial scanners often provide more advanced features, automated reporting, and dedicated support. Consider your budget and needs when selecting a paid option. Some examples include Sucuri SiteCheck and Wordfence.
3. Performing the WordPress Vulnerability Scan
With your VM set up and a scanner selected, it’s time to perform the scan.
3.1 Configuring the Scanner
Most scanners require configuration, including specifying the target URL (your WordPress site within the VM) and selecting the appropriate scan type. Pay close attention to the scanner’s documentation for detailed instructions.
3.2 Initiating the Scan
Once configured, initiate the scan. The duration varies depending on the scanner, scan type, and website size. Larger sites may take longer to scan comprehensively.
3.3 Analyzing the Scan Results
After the scan completes, carefully review the results. The scanner will identify potential vulnerabilities, categorizing them by severity (critical, high, medium, low). Prioritize addressing critical vulnerabilities first.
4. Identifying and Addressing Vulnerabilities
Identifying vulnerabilities is only half the battle; addressing them effectively is crucial.
4.1 Understanding the Vulnerabilities
Don’t just blindly follow automated fixes. Understand the nature of each vulnerability before taking action. Consult the scanner’s documentation or online resources for detailed explanations.
4.2 Implementing Security Fixes
Update WordPress core, themes, and plugins to their latest versions. This addresses many common vulnerabilities. Properly secure your database and server configurations, ensuring strong passwords and user roles.
4.3 Regular Security Audits
Regular security audits are essential to maintaining a robust security posture. This can include manual code reviews, penetration testing by security specialists, and continuous monitoring for emerging threats. A WordPress vulnerability scan should be a recurring task, not a one-time event.
5. Post-Scan Security Hardening
After addressing the identified vulnerabilities, further securing your WordPress environment is vital.
5.1 Strengthening Passwords and User Roles
Utilize strong, unique passwords for all user accounts and implement the principle of least privilege, assigning users roles with only necessary permissions.
5.2 Implementing Two-Factor Authentication (2FA)
2FA adds an extra layer of security, making it significantly harder for attackers to gain unauthorized access, even if they obtain your password.
5.3 Regular Backups
Regular backups are essential. If your site is compromised, you can restore it quickly from a clean backup, minimizing disruption and data loss.
WordPress Vulnerability Scanning: Best Practices
- Regular Scanning: Perform scans at least once a month, or even more frequently if you’re frequently updating your plugins or themes. Consider continuous monitoring services for proactive threat detection.
- Multiple Scanners: Using multiple scanners can provide a more comprehensive assessment of your site’s security. Different scanners may identify different vulnerabilities.
- False Positives: Be aware that scanners might occasionally report false positives. Manually verify any identified vulnerabilities before implementing fixes.
- Stay Updated: Keep your WordPress installation, plugins, and themes up-to-date. Regular updates often include security patches.
- Secure Hosting: Choose a reputable web hosting provider that offers robust security features.
FAQ
Q1: Is using VirtualBox essential for WordPress vulnerability scanning? While not strictly mandatory for all scans (some scanners offer online scans), using VirtualBox is highly recommended. It provides a safe, isolated environment to test vulnerabilities without risking your live website.
Q2: What if I find vulnerabilities I can’t fix? If you encounter vulnerabilities beyond your technical expertise, consider seeking assistance from a cybersecurity professional or WordPress security expert.
Q3: How often should I perform a WordPress vulnerability scan? Ideally, you should perform vulnerability scans at least monthly. More frequent scans are recommended for high-traffic sites or sites with frequently updated plugins and themes. Consider setting up automated scans using scheduled tasks.
Conclusion
Regular WordPress vulnerability scanning is a critical part of website security. By following these five steps and implementing the suggested best practices, you can significantly reduce the risk of cyberattacks and protect your website and its data. Remember that proactive security measures, including regular scans and updates, are far more effective and less costly than reactive measures after a breach. Start your own WordPress vulnerability scan today and secure your online presence.
Call to Action: Ready to strengthen your WordPress security? Explore our comprehensive WordPress security guide for advanced tips and techniques! [Link to your hypothetical guide]
We’ve covered five crucial steps for effectively scanning your WordPress installation for vulnerabilities within a secure VirtualBox environment. This process, while detailed, is essential for proactive website security. Remember, neglecting regular security checks can leave your site exposed to various threats, ranging from minor inconvenience to significant data breaches and financial losses. Furthermore, understanding the intricacies of vulnerability scanning allows you to not only identify weaknesses but also to appreciate the underlying mechanisms exploited by malicious actors. Consequently, this knowledge empowers you to implement more robust security measures and make more informed decisions about your website’s defenses. In short, mastering these techniques is a vital step in maintaining the health and integrity of your online presence. Finally, it’s important to note that while VirtualBox provides a safe testing ground, always back up your WordPress site before conducting any significant security scans or applying any changes. This precaution minimizes the risk of irreversible damage should something go wrong during the process. Therefore, combining careful testing with comprehensive backups significantly reduces the potential for negative outcomes.
Beyond the steps outlined, it’s crucial to consider ongoing security practices. This includes regularly updating your WordPress core files, plugins, and themes. Moreover, implementing strong password policies for all user accounts is paramount. In addition, consider utilizing a reputable security plugin that offers real-time protection and vulnerability scanning capabilities. These plugins often provide additional layers of defense, actively monitoring for suspicious activity and alerting you to potential threats. Similarly, actively engaging with the WordPress community and staying informed about prevalent security vulnerabilities can help you proactively address potential issues before they impact your website. As a result, staying up-to-date on the latest security news and best practices will significantly enhance your website’s resilience. In fact, proactive measures are far more effective and cost-efficient than reactive damage control. Therefore, adopt a holistic approach to security, encompassing both technical safeguards and ongoing vigilance.
While this guide provides a solid foundation, the world of WordPress security is constantly evolving. New vulnerabilities are discovered regularly, and attackers constantly refine their techniques. Therefore, it is essential to continue your education and remain informed about the latest threats and best practices. Investing time in understanding security concepts will not only protect your website but will also increase your overall understanding of web development and security principles. Subsequently, this deeper understanding will prove invaluable in various aspects of your online endeavors. To that end, we encourage you to explore further resources and delve deeper into WordPress security. Remember, security is an ongoing process, not a one-time fix. Consequently, consistent monitoring, updating, and proactive measures are critical for maintaining a secure and reliable WordPress website. In conclusion, by combining the steps outlined in this guide with continuous learning and vigilance, you can significantly enhance the security of your valuable WordPress installation.
.